Overview
Reverend Dugald Butler (1862-1926) was the British author of: Ancient Church and Parish of Abernethy (1897), John Wesley and George Whitefield in Scotland (1898), Henry Scougal and the Oxford Methodists (1899), Scottish Cathedrals and Abbeys (with Herbert Story) (1901), Life and Letters of Archbishop Leighton (1903), Eternal Elements in the Christian Faith (1905), The Tron Kirk of Edinburgh (1906), Thomas a Kempis: a Religious Study (1908), Gothic Architecture: its Christian Origin and Inspiration (1910), Woman and the Church in Scottish History (1912), Life of St. Cuthbert (1913), Life of St. Giles (1914), Lindean and Galashiels; or, Abbeys, Church, Manor and Town (1915), Prayer in Experience (1922) and Jottings of an Invalid (1924).
